Ive been to wdw 4 times and love it, ive usually gone around august September time, were now planning to go next year, when do you think is the best time? march, September or November, don't want it too hot or too busy as its my partners first visit? don't want the water parks to be shut either:banana:
 
We have gone in October and found it to be a great time. Still warm enough to enjoy the pool and waterparks, but not quite as humid. You will have to check the refurbishment list to see which waterpark may be closed on the dates you go. Also, don't forget the food festival :thumbsup2

We loved the low crowds this past January. I have been in September and aside from the heat, it is a great time to go.
 
I plan around free dining. I have gone 3 times in September and have found the week after Labor day to be best in September. I really enjoyed the end of January this year, but it was colder for swimming when we went. We did still get 3 days of swimming in and I loved the weather because I wasn't dying from heat.
